Course Content

• Introduction to Neural Networks and Deep Learning
• Fundamentals of Remote Sensing and Data Acquisition
• Convolutional Neural Networks (CNNs) for Image Classification in Remote Sensing
• Recurrent Neural Networks (RNNs) and Long Short-Term Memory (LSTM) networks for Time Series Analysis in Remote Event Detection
• Neural Network Architectures for Specific Remote Events (e.g., wildfire, flood, earthquake detection)
• Data Preprocessing and Feature Extraction for Remote Sensing Data
• Model Training, Validation, and Evaluation Metrics
• Deployment and Real-time Application of Neural Networks for Remote Event Detection
• Case Studies and Applications of Neural Networks in Remote Sensing
• Ethical Considerations and Societal Impact of AI in Remote Sensing

Career Role (Neural Networks & Remote Event Detection) Description
AI/ML Engineer (Remote Sensing) Develops and deploys neural network models for real-time remote event detection, focusing on efficient algorithms and scalable infrastructure. High demand in UK defense and environmental monitoring.
Data Scientist (Remote Event Analysis) Analyzes large datasets from remote sensors using neural networks, identifying patterns and insights relevant to security, infrastructure, or environmental events. Requires strong statistical modeling and data visualization skills.
Software Engineer (Neural Network Deployment) Designs and implements robust software solutions for deploying and managing neural network models for remote event detection, ensuring high availability and performance. Experience with cloud platforms crucial.
Research Scientist (Remote Sensing AI) Conducts cutting-edge research in neural networks and their application to remote event detection, pushing the boundaries of the field. Publishes findings and contributes to advancements in AI technology.
